Well of all the songs we expected to see released today, the latest from UK pop star Will Young was probably the last.
But after a four year hiatus from music, Will’s back.
And not only does he drop his new single ‘All The Songs’ today, but he also confirms the upcoming release of his seventh studio album ‘Lexicon’ (cover art above).
It’s his first as an independent artist too, after he severed ties with Island Records following his 2015 long player ‘85% Proof’.
And it’s a return to straight-out pop for the affable performer here.
It feels like a slide back to the sublime electronic pop that his 2011 long player ‘Echoes’ (still our favourite WY record to date) served up.
